The case for animal experiments is that they will produce such great benefits for humanity that it is morally acceptable to harm a few animals. The consequentialist justification of animal experimentation can be demonstrated by comparing the moral consequences of doing or not doing an experiment. The three Rs are a set of principles that scientists are encouraged to follow in order to reduce the impact of research on animals. /Type /Group Moreover, it requires a recognition of animal suffering and a satisfactory working through of that suffering in terms of one's ethical values.
